Height gets all the attention and diameter gets almost none, which is backwards. A bar at a slightly wrong height is still usable. A bar too thick to close your hand around is not a grab bar at all, whatever the packaging says.
Why 1¼ to 1½ inches wins
The thing you need in a slip is a power grip: fingers wrapped past the far side of the bar, thumb coming round to meet them. That closed loop is what lets you hold on when your feet have already gone. An open hand pressing down on a surface does almost nothing once you are falling.
At 1¼″ almost every adult hand closes comfortably. At 1½″ most still do, and the extra thickness spreads load across the palm, which matters for arthritic hands. Past 2″ the loop opens up, and for someone with small hands or limited finger movement it never closes at all.
This is also why a towel bar is not a substitute even when it is anchored well. Many are flat or square-edged, so there is nothing to wrap around, and the edge concentrates all the load onto one line across your fingers.
What about square and oval bars
They are allowed and some are excellent. The measurement changes: instead of diameter you check the perimeter, which should land between 4″ and 4⅓″ or so, with no single cross-section dimension past about 2¼″.
Practically: wrap a strip of paper around it, mark where it meets, measure the strip. If the bar has sharp corners, skip it regardless of the numbers. Corners hurt under load and a hand in pain lets go.
Choosing the length
Length is not about the wall, it is about the distance the person’s hand travels while they are unsteady. Longer is almost always better, and the usual mistake is buying too short because it looks tidier.
Rough guide. A 12–16″ bar is a single-grip assist: getting up off the toilet, one hand, one position. An 18–24″ bar lets the hand slide along as the body moves, which is what you want beside a toilet or at a shower entry. A 32–42″ bar spans a tub or shower wall so there is something to hold at every point of the transfer, and that is the one people wish they had bought.
Two practical constraints. The bar must land on real structure at both ends, so the available stud positions may set your length before your preference does. And it should not stop short of where the feet are most likely to slide, which in a tub is the far end, not the middle.
A longer bar does not hold more. Capacity comes from the anchors and the structure behind them, and every bar someone puts weight on should be rated to 250 lbf and fixed into blocking or studs. How to check a bar before you buy it
Close your own hand around it in the shop, or around a pipe of the stated diameter at home. If your thumb does not reach your fingers, it is too thick for you and it will be much too thick for a weaker hand. Then check the stated load rating and the mounting flange size, because a small flange with two screw holes cannot carry a rated load no matter what the box claims.
